Sunroom window repair services focus on restoring the functionality and appearance of windows within sunrooms. This process typically involves fixing damaged or broken glass, addressing issues with window frames, and resealing or weatherproofing to prevent drafts and leaks.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ing windows and perform necessary repairs to improve insulation, safety, and overall aesthetics. Proper repair work can help extend the lifespan of sunroom windows and maintain the structural integrity of the space.

Many common problems that sunroom window repair services address include cracked or shattered glass, warped or rotting frames, and deteriorated seals. These issues can lead to energy loss, increased utility bills, and potential water damage during inclement weather. Repair technicians often replace broken glass panes, reinforce or replace compromised framing, and reseal gaps to ensure the sunroom remains comfortable and protected from outdoor elements.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ent further damage and reduce the need for more extensive repairs or replacements in the future.

The overview below groups typical Sunroom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Snohomish,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for sunroom window repairs 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age and window size. For example, a standard repair might be around $250, while more extensive work could approach $600.

Material Expenses - Replacing window panes or frames can vary widely, with material costs generally between $100 and $400 per window. The choice of glass or framing material influences the overall price, with custom or high-end options costing more.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for sunroom window repairs us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the number of windows involved, often totaling between $200 and $800.

Additional Costs - Unexpected issues such as rot or structural damage may increase costs, potentially adding $100 to $500 to the repair bill.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on the specific condition of the sunroom windows.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can be repaired on sunroom windows? Local service providers can repair issues such as cracked glass, broken seals, fogging, and frame damage to restore the functionality and appearance of sunroom windows.

How long does a typical sunroom window repair take? Repair times vary depending on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by experienced contractors.

Are there options to upgrade or replace sunroom windows instead of repairing them? Yes, local pros can offer replacement options with new, energy-efficient windows if repairs are not feasible or desired.

What should be considered before repairing a sunroom window? It’s important to assess the extent of damage, the age of the window, and whether repairs or replacement will provide the best long-term solution.
